Handover: Contrast Audit on Glimmerpane — Priya → Tomas. Hey Tomas, I finished the first pass of the color-contrast audit on the Glimmerpane dashboard. Most failures are in the muted badge palette; chart legends are borderline. I bumped the checker thresholds in staging so it flags AA misses only. The checker reads its thresholds and palette overrides from these values:

config for bahop-fajep:
DRUATH_PIN=4501
DRUATH_TENANT=briwyn
DRUATH_METRICS_HOST=metrics.druath.brasksoft.test
DRUATH_SEAL=seal_7d2e069d
DRUATH_STANDBY_TEAM=olieth

Saltmere Calendar Sync — conflict limits. When two writers edit the same event, the resolver retries with backoff before flagging a manual-merge item. Exceeding the per-tenant conflict quota pauses sync for that tenant; unpause via the admin console only after the backlog drains. Alerts route to the sync on-call channel. Current quota and retry constants follow.

tuning constants:
QUOTAS = {
    "druwyn": 5,
    "holix": 5,
    "zorath": 5,
    "holwyn": 10,
}

# GC tuning for matchwell-core
#
# We saw 400ms+ pauses under peak load, so heap is capped at 6g and
# the pause target set to 40ms. Don't bump heap without checking the
# pause dashboard first. Match outcomes are flushed to the results DB
# on each cycle, connecting via the string below:

primary connection of yaguf-tagug = mongodb://sorox_svc:RmJoU4HZbLmruH@db-0593.qorvelworks.internal:5432/fraius

## Wavecrest Preview — Environments

Wavecrest renders audio waveform previews for uploads. Three environments: dev (local renderer, no queue), staging (shared queue, synthetic uploads), prod (autoscaled renderers, real traffic). Previews cache for 24h in staging, 7d in prod. New team members: never point dev at the prod bucket. Each environment boots from its own config; the prod values are listed below.

deployment values, faduf-tawep:
SORDOR_LOG_LEVEL=error
SORDOR_METRICS_HOST=metrics.sordor.nelvrolabs.internal
SORDOR_POOL_SIZE=4